    March 14, 2024 at 9:39 am in reply to: Hot and cold effects on symptoms

    I too am very affected by temperature changes or any delay in taking my Sinemet, even the wearing off period before the next dose, with shivers and shakes. I live in southern Spain where the temperatures can fluctuate hugely. I have air conditioning units in the most used rooms, with which I can rapidly raise or lower the temperature, a fan heater in the bathroom, and layers of sweaters to adjust as needed.

    October 19, 2022 at 8:12 am in reply to: Urinary and Bowell Movement problems

    I had serious and painful constipation problems, requiring glycerine suppositories, but was then advised to cut way down on meat and to increase fibre and fruit. I found that breakfast of muesli with additional wheat and oat bran and berries, and stewed prunes with every meal and at other intervals – total about 150 grams a day. Wonderful relief, bowel movements about every 24 to 30 hours without strain.
